Output 03864a442854f7f329ad1394e1a98a4dc8f5fb5f57703cbdc6862d2a97b64607:0

value
20840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b61bda66fdda50c35cebe7072c493ea6bd481add OP_EQUAL
address
3JHvGj6SB6GcuXLqHsbYm7ac8mGgpwQd4K
transaction
03864a442854f7f329ad1394e1a98a4dc8f5fb5f57703cbdc6862d2a97b64607
spent
true